Biffy Clyro's biography begins in Scotland starting in 1995. Their lineup has stayed consistent for the duration of their activity, with Simon Neil on guitar, James Johnston playing bass, and Ben Johnston handling drums. Simon Neil serves as the primary vocalist and lyricist, but all three have participated with vocals and songwriting.
Over the course of their previous seven albums, Biffy Clyro have topped the charts, headlined numerous huge festivals, performed all over the globe, including tours with Linkin Park, Queens of the Stone Age, and Muse and earned countless awards.
Biffy Clyro’s biggest hits include “Many of Horror (When We Collide)”, “Bubbles”, “Black Chandelier”, “Biblical”, “Re-arrange” and “Mountains”. The iconic Biffy Clyro catalogue also includes the albums “Blackened Sky”, “The Vertigo of Bliss”, “Puzzle”, “Only Revolutions”, “Opposites” and “Ellipsis”.
